Ravens guards Chris Chester, Ben Grubbs and Matt Birk vs. Bengals MLB Dhani Jones
The Ravens are quick and athletic, and will need to be both against Jones. The Ravens have to be able to get to him and cut off his pursuit angles. Jones leads the Bengals in tackles with 153, including 100 solo. He is fast and extremely agile. Edge: Bengals
Ravens CB Chris Carr vs. Bengals WR Jordan Shipley
Shipley isn't overly big or fast, but he can find holes in a zone defense, especially in the red zone. As the slot receiver, he is a good matchup for any No. 3 safety or cornerback. He is tough and plays a lot bigger than he looks. Carr starts outside in the base defense but goes inside on the nickel because he is smart and good at recognition and communicating. Carr has had an outstanding season, but so has Shipley. This is an excellent matchup. Edge: Ravens
Ravens inside linebackers Ray Lewis and Jameel McClain vs. Bengals RB Cedric Benson
Benson is the key to the Bengals' offense. Cincinnati likes to pass, mostly off play-action. Benson is versatile enough to gain yards inside and outside. McClain has replaced Lewis as the rabbit inside. In the past three games, he has been making plays all over the field and running down halfbacks. Lewis has to get the Ravens ready before each snap. The Bengals caught San Diego off-guard last week by snapping the ball before the Chargers' defense was set. Edge: Ravens
